University of Iceland and Hólar University to Merge

The University of Iceland and Hólar University are set to merge from 1 July after legislation paving the way for the move was approved by Iceland’s parliament. As reported by RÚV , the merger will see the two institutions operate within the newly established University of Iceland University Complex. Iceland's parliament has approved legislation enabling the merger of the University of Iceland and Hólar University, effective July 1st. Both institutions will operate under the newly formed University of Iceland University Complex. This consolidation is part of broader reforms initiated in 2023 to enhance efficiency and educational quality within the nation's higher education system.

Hólar University, with its focus on aquaculture, equine science, and tourism, will maintain some autonomy but will see organizational changes, including a new presidential role and a continued governing board. The government also plans substantial investment in new teaching facilities at Hólar and in the nearby town of Sauðárkrókur.

This merger aims to create a more robust and efficient higher education system in Iceland, potentially leading to improved research capabilities and educational offerings.
